electrojet in American English
a narrow, high-velocity stream of electric energy that girdles the earth in the ionosphere above the magnetic equator and near the auroral displays
noun: a current of ions existing in the upper atmosphere, moving with respect to the surface of the earth, and causing various auroral phenomena

electrojet in British English
noun: a narrow belt of fast-moving ions in the ionosphere, under the influence of the earth's magnetic field, causing auroral displays
